Historic Investment Pledges
- US investment pledges in Saudi Arabia’s AI sector surged from $3 billion to over $21 billion
- Google Cloud and the Public Investment Fund announced an expanded strategic partnership, projected to contribute approximately $70.6 billion to Saudi Arabia’s GDP
The series of announcements reflect Riyadh’s growing ambition to become a global hub for artificial intelligence, backed by top-tier US tech leadership and capital. The investment pledges are expected to play a key role in shaping the future of the Saudi AI sector.
The Impact of the Visit on the Saudi AI Sector
- NVIDIA delivered 18,000 next-generation AI chips to HUMAIN, a Saudi AI innovation venture
- The move is expected to open the floodgates for artificial intelligence semiconductors across the Middle East
The delivery of NVIDIA’s high-performance chips marks a major step towards establishing a regional AI infrastructure capable of supporting large-scale machine learning, cloud computing, and autonomous systems. Policy Reversal and Its Implications
The US Commerce Department announced it would scrap Biden’s “AI deployment rule,” which had created three broad tiers of access for countries seeking to acquire AI chips.
The reversal signals a significant policy pivot, potentially expanding access to powerful AI technology for key allies in the region, including Saudi Arabia. The move is seen as a major step towards creating a more collaborative and cooperative relationship between the US and Saudi Arabia.
Job Creation and Economic Growth
- Prince Faisal bin Farhan affirmed that the Kingdom’s strategic partnership with the US in artificial intelligence and hyperscale data centers is expected to generate more than 22,000 high-quality jobs
